Engine
Pratt & Whitney "Wasp Junior SB" (higher compression ratio) R985 (985 Cu Inch / 16lt approx displacement Air Cooled (no cowls or shutters) 9-cylinder Supercharged Radial Piston Engine
Rated
400 bhp (METO) at 5000' 450 bhp at takeoff power
Propeller
It drives a Hartzell 3 Blade constant speed propeller

SuperCharger
Centrifugal forces via impeller compress air prior to entry into piston canister. This higher air density improves performance. Beware overboost at sea level/low altitude watch MAP.
